Duration and Pricing
This family rafting adventure in Golden, BC offers a duration of 4 hours total, including 1.5 hours of exhilarating rafting on the Kicking Horse River.
The experience costs from $76.66 per person, with free cancellation up to 24 hours in advance for a full refund.
The activity includes a safety briefing, riverside BBQ lunch, and round-trip bus transport.
While not suitable for children under 4 or 33 lbs, the rafting adventure promises scenic mountain views and a fun, guided experience for the whole family.
Itinerary and Activities
Rafting enthusiasts embark on their 4-hour adventure starting at the Glacier Raft Company’s rafting base located at 1509 Lafontaine Rd in Golden.
The itinerary includes:
-
A 25-minute safety briefing to prepare participants for the thrilling ride ahead.
-
1.5 hours of rafting on the renowned Kicking Horse River, offering scenic views of the Canadian Rockies, forests, and waterfalls.
-
A 45-minute riverside BBQ lunch to refuel.
-
A 20-minute return bus ride to the starting point.
Throughout the journey, participants are guided by experienced river guides, ensuring a safe and unforgettable family-friendly experience.

The rafting adventure includes all necessary equipment, such as wetsuits, boots, splash tops, helmets, personal flotation devices (PFDs), and paddles.
A BBQ lunch is provided, and transportation to and from the river is included.
The experience isn’t suitable for children under 4 years or under 33 lbs (15 kg). Participants should bring swimwear and a towel.
No intoxication, alcohol, or drugs are allowed. Safety is paramount, and an experienced river guide leads the group.
